**住宅服务器SSL证书配置指南**,SSL证书是保障网络数据安全的重要工具,为住宅服务器配置SSL证书至关重要,需选择合适的SSL证书类型及提供商;准备必要的配置文件;进行安装与测试,配置过程中,注意遵循相关标准和最佳实践,确保证书安装正确且无安全隐患,配置完成后,用户可通过安全连接访问住宅服务器,保护个人隐私和信息安全,本指南将助力您轻松完成SSL证书配置,享受更安全的网络环境。
随着互联网的普及和网络安全的重要性日益凸显,SSL证书作为保障网络通信安全的重要工具,在住宅服务器上的配置也变得愈发重要,本文将为您详细解读住宅服务器SSL证书的配置过程,帮助您确保家庭网络环境的安全性和私密性。
选择合适的SSL证书
在开始配置之前,首先需要选择一款适合您需求的SSL证书,市场上有免费和付费两种类型的SSL证书可供选择,其中免费的SSL证书主要以花生油为原料制成,具有良好的性价比;而付费的SSL证书则提供更强大的功能和更好的支持,但价格相对较高,根据您的实际需求和安全级别,选择最合适的SSL证书类型。
安装SSL证书
在选择好SSL证书后,接下来需要在住宅服务器上进行安装,具体步骤如下:
-
获取SSL证书文件:通常情况下,SSL证书包括两个文件:
.crt(证书文件)和.key(私钥文件),这些文件可以从证书颁发机构(CA)处购买并下载。 -
安装证书文件:将下载好的
.crt和.key文件上传到住宅服务器上,在服务器上,找到并打开Web服务器的配置文件(如Apache的httpd.conf或Nginx的nginx.conf),然后添加以下代码:
SSLCertificateFile /path/to/your_domain.crt SSLCertificateKeyFile /path/to/your_domain.key
将上述代码中的路径替换为您实际保存SSL证书文件的路径。
- 重启Web服务器:保存配置文件并重启Web服务器以使更改生效,对于Apache,可以使用以下命令:
sudo systemctl restart httpd
对于Nginx,可以使用以下命令:
sudo systemctl restart nginx
验证SSL证书安装
安装完成后,您需要验证SSL证书是否正确安装,可以通过浏览器的安全锁标志来检查SSL证书的有效性,还可以使用在线SSL检查工具(如SSL Labs的SSL Server Test)来扫描您的网站并检查其安全性。
配置HTTP重定向到HTTPS
为了确保所有网络流量都通过HTTPS传输,建议在住宅服务器上配置HTTP到HTTPS的重定向,这可以通过在Web服务器配置文件中添加以下代码来实现:
对于Apache:
<VirtualHost *:80>
ServerName your_domain.com
Redirect permanent / https://your_domain.com/
</VirtualHost>
<VirtualHost *:443>
ServerName your_domain.com
# 在此处添加其他虚拟主机配置
</VirtualHost>
对于Nginx:
server {
listen 80;
server_name your_domain.com;
return 301 https://$host$request_uri;
}
server {
listen 443 ssl;
server_name your_domain.com;
# 在此处添加其他虚拟主机配置
}
完成以上步骤后,您的住宅服务器SSL证书配置就完成了,这不仅可以保护您的网络通信免受第三方窃听和篡改,还可以提高您的网站信誉度和用户信任度。